Commit Graph

53 Commits

Author SHA1 Message Date
AffectedArc07
88f71cc151 Bumps to DreamChecker 1.4 2020-06-20 10:51:26 +01:00
Regular-Joe-SF
826cefeca7 Adds new SecHUD designations and tweaks secHUD on examining (updated 22 May) (#12666)
* Add new criminal_status

* Add new criminal_status

* Update security.dm

Add new criminal_statuses to sec records console

* Fix beepsky not arresting executees

* Sechud now shows latest comment on examination

* Update human.dm

Add new criminal_status

* Update hud.dmi

Add new sechud icons, animated hudexecute

* Sechud now shows latest comment on examination

Simplified it according to farie's notes

* Sechud now shows latest comment on examination

Once more, thanks Henk!

* Sechud now shows latest comment on examination

Per Henk's review, another one bites the dust.

* Machinery threatcounts fixed

I just noticed that actually this doesn't affect beepsky, but turrets at portable_turret.dm. Well, now there they are.

* Turret threatcounts fixed

Now it should be proper: execute status now counts as threat to turrets.

* Update hud.dmi

New sechud statuses. Hourglass symbol for search status

* Update hud.dmi

DISREGARD: Test commit for affected on icondiffbot

* Update hud.dmi

New sechud statuses. Hourglass symbol for search status

* Revert "Update hud.dmi"

This reverts commit 8deaf40679.

* New sechud statuses. Zoomglass for search status (now).

* New sechud statuses

Make ghosts with all HUDs or sechud enabled able to use the examine function of sechud.

* Add new sec statuses

LF and conflicts resolved

* add new sec statuses

LF and conflicts resolved

* fix turret threatcounts

LF and conflicts resolved

* add new sec statuses

LF and conflicts resolved

* add new sec statuses, add sechud ghost examine

LF and conflicts resolved

* Add new sec statuses

LF and conflict resolving take2

* Add new sec stasuses

LF and conflict resolve take2, rid with empty lines

* Fixing Travis warning on list access at 355

* On built fail

trailing newlines accidentially forgotten, check, warning on list access, better but still not gone (got to git gut)

* Fixing usage of LAZYACCESS

Yeah - there was just un-necessary stuff there. Thanks to AA and Farie for help

* One last un-necessary thing off

* Move criminal status to defines.

Per Farie request: criminal statuses are now defines, every usage of them moved to utilize them. Minor: CC evilfax uses now 'demote' status in demote reply

* Beepsky prisoner threatcount: status quo

back to what it was since indeed, it becomes a nuisance if he tried to chase prisoners in jail

* Requests done

Removed useless check from secrecordComment, used isobserver at ghost omnihud

* re-add isobserver check

My bad, this check actually gives ghosts the View Comment Log from the HUD where they can't interact with the other buttons. I guess this is exactly why you comment code

* More sane expression on check at secrecordComment

As requested!

Co-authored-by: xXx-RegularJoe-xXx <53127823+xXx-RegularJoe-xXx@users.noreply.github.com>
2020-05-23 11:26:48 -06:00
AffectedArc07
210f8badf4 Makes all global variables handled by the GLOB controller (#13152)
* Handlers converted, now to fix 3532 compile errors

* 3532 compile fixes later, got runtimes on startup

* Well the server loads now atleast

* Take 2

* Oops
2020-03-20 21:56:37 -06:00
AffectedArc07
04ba5c1cc9 File standardisation (#13131)
* Adds the check components

* Adds in trailing newlines

* Converts all CRLF to LF

* Post merge EOF

* Post merge line endings

* Final commit
2020-03-17 18:08:51 -04:00
Fox McCloud
20c4cf0a08 for-if-I-stand-I-stand-by-his-will-alone 2019-10-03 19:52:03 -04:00
AffectedArc07
ec790efeaa SSticker 2019-04-30 16:47:47 +01:00
Fox McCloud
d0ea5ee8b9 Crit Rework Final Submission 2019-03-28 17:28:00 -04:00
Fox McCloud
dc09d07d86 Reduces Defib Safe Time: Adds Health HUD Defib Indicator 2019-02-07 00:49:24 -05:00
joep van der velden
5d357becfc Cling regenerative stasis now appears as if the cling is dead on the med HUDs 2018-11-04 17:16:31 +01:00
Fox McCloud
89ec155432 Abductor Update 2018-07-24 19:49:10 -04:00
Fox McCloud
5c4aa9b3fd Removes All Weapons 2018-04-15 16:25:56 -04:00
Aurorablade
2921d35037 fixed it. 2018-02-04 21:19:22 -05:00
Aurorablade
cc7e6fabe8 Fixes Med huds 2018-02-02 02:18:06 -05:00
Aurorablade
5301e37f22 Reverts health rounding changes 2017-12-02 18:26:58 -05:00
Aurorablade
dc6bb34b38 More hud stuff 2017-11-28 23:17:50 -05:00
Aurorablade
64c4883cc2 paths 2017-11-28 21:10:59 -05:00
Kyep
5c83dccdd1 Adds 'Execute' status 2017-09-04 00:49:09 -07:00
Fox-McCloud
b366f5e598 Makes has_brain_worms cheaper 2017-08-04 23:37:17 -04:00
Fox-McCloud
17d7232cf3 Removes Disease one and Virology 2017-07-08 23:10:17 -04:00
Vivalas
afce15fe3d Sechud t w e a k 2017-06-29 14:17:02 -05:00
Sam
932cae0224 Loyalty implant -> Mindshield Implant 2017-04-09 16:50:51 +01:00
Crazy Lemon
d26835747b Merge pull request #6103 from uraniummeltdown/borerimprove
Better Borers
2017-02-14 21:43:56 -08:00
Crazy Lemon
32bbf77be6 Merge pull request #6286 from uraniummeltdown/aimech
AI control beacons for mechs
2017-02-06 04:04:34 -08:00
uraniummeltdown
232ae66e1c Merge remote-tracking branch 'remotes/upstream/master' into borerimprove
# Conflicts:
#	icons/mob/actions.dmi
2017-02-05 17:58:30 +04:00
uraniummeltdown
8c10df3bd3 adds AI control beacons to exofab, mechs with these installed can be controlled by any AIs
adds diag hud icons for mechs with tracking beacons installed
2017-01-31 20:14:05 +04:00
uraniummeltdown
7c73fd627e resolve conflicts 2017-01-27 22:48:01 +04:00
Fox-McCloud
ea76990b7a Botany Rework 2017-01-21 18:28:03 -05:00
Flufflemonster
b9cca501be Update data_huds.dm 2017-01-10 13:06:53 -07:00
Puckaboo2
94e0054b60 Finalized Medical HUD Interface Update 2017-01-09 16:06:02 -07:00
uraniummeltdown
33c0f34d52 borer improvements from TG 2017-01-07 17:23:04 +04:00
Fox McCloud
be8cc0432d Merge pull request #4691 from taukausanake/plant_hud
Hydroponics HUD
2016-07-15 21:47:36 -04:00
Tigercat2000
71e5344a98 Mass replace 2016-07-07 19:34:02 -07:00
taukausanake
c995cc036e I don't want Tiger to bite my head off 2016-06-23 17:14:05 -05:00
taukausanake
35457bd80c Forgot to remove bee HUD
Yeah, can't do this so removing it. Maybe I'll revisit it once I can muster enough thought processing on it
2016-06-22 23:20:50 -05:00
taukausanake
4b274dd00f This should be it
Removed special check for plants. Bees undo it all so it's not worth the trouble just yet.
Credit for Crazylemon for being best coder. He helped me find a lot of issues that I would have been too stupid to find myself. Runtimes are gone
2016-06-22 23:03:09 -05:00
taukausanake
5f129c5ba4 Merge branch 'master' of https://github.com/ParadiseSS13/Paradise into plant_hud 2016-06-21 18:21:31 -05:00
Mieszko Jędrzejczak
876ab1cdd8 Makes the medical HUD overlay smoother (#4726)
* Smoother medical hud

* Port's /tg/'s neat flashy thingies.
2016-06-21 16:56:31 -04:00
taukausanake
3dd3dabe24 Final push
unless someone says no. Everything should be good however I noticed some runtimes with the nutrient and water HUDs. Maybe some floating point problems but those two shouldn't do decimal values. Otherwise the only other issue I can thing is that the HUDs don't update immediately every time.They still update when they should but I've noticed some irregularities...
2016-06-20 23:49:07 -05:00
taukausanake
55326e1c70 Technical difficulties
Decided to scrap the beekeeping HUD for now. Turned out it's way more complicated that I thought. I'll try it again in the future.
Added the Hydro HUD design for Protolathe. Need to test if it works.
Might have made a mistake in Git so commiting in order to pull from Paradise master to see if anything broke.
2016-06-20 11:20:32 -05:00
taukausanake
eec29a3e9c I DID IT
Finally got the HUDs to work all thanks to Crazylemon. The only thing that doesn't work is the hudharvest2 is_type_in_list() check I made but I could get rid of it
2016-06-18 18:10:31 -05:00
taukausanake
e9d9a4c345 Mistakes were made 2016-06-15 19:11:49 -05:00
taukausanake
130096aced Hydroponic HUDs
Everything is done. Except it doesn't work. I must be missing something somewhere but otherwise I did everything that appeared needing to do. Based it off of mech diag HUD so that might be the issue.
Code as of now does not let you join the server. Need to revert bit by bit and find out what I did wrong
2016-06-09 17:46:09 -05:00
Tastyfish
6a8ea815b2 Merge branch 'master' into buttbots2
Conflicts:
	code/defines/procs/AStar.dm
	code/modules/mob/living/simple_animal/bot/cleanbot.dm
	code/modules/mob/living/simple_animal/bot/medbot.dm
	paradise.dme
2016-03-31 13:33:46 -04:00
Tigercat2000
ad2cf86898 -tg- disease1
Wee! Readds Disease1, kills off disease2, and finally removes poop.dmi
(fucking piece of shit)

Needs WAY more testing, most of which I don't know how to do yet, because
I've never used this system. Fun!

Changes:
 - Virus2 has been removed completely.
  - Some symptoms have not been readded. Aka, none of them have been
    readded, I just wanted to get this shit ported.
  - Virology has been updated slightly to mirror -tg-'s boxstation, as the
    virus2 machines are gone.
 - Welcome back, disease1
  - The centrifuge, vials, splicer, analyzer, growerthing, have all been
    replaced by the PanD.E.M.I.C. 2220
  - No symptoms have been completely removed; However, vision symptoms
    have been disabled pending byond 510, and genetics symptoms have been
    disabled until "when I figure out how to fix them".
  - Advanced Mutation Toxin now uses a disease, which turns people from
    species, to slime person, to slime. Slime people are instantly turned
    to a slime.
  - Diseased touch now give people appendicitis. Yes, they VANT YOUR...
    appendix.
  - Virology now has a fridge with the following in it:
    - Antiviral Syringes
    - 1 Rhinovirus culture
    - 1 Flu culture
    - 1 Bottle of Mutagen
    - 1 Bottle of Plasma
    - 1 Bottle of Synaptizine
  - A few more things, which I can't remember and can't look at while writing
    this commit. Sometimes, git hurts.

TODO:
 - Test more shit and figure out how the PanD.E.M.I.C. works/is supposed to
   work.
 - Fix genetics symptoms.
 - Give vampires a less shitty diseased touch.
 - Add appendicitis event.
 -
2016-03-27 21:24:00 -07:00
Tastyfish
25195208a9 Ports tg simple_animal bots 2016-03-28 00:22:04 -04:00
Aurorablade
6eac1092bb hate the mask of narnar 2015-12-15 22:27:30 -05:00
Aurorablade
95d8b50345 hud_updateflag purge!
EXTERMINATUS BITCH
2015-12-13 17:16:14 -05:00
Aurorablade
0770171c2f i forgot to remove a thing.... 2015-12-12 19:22:03 -05:00
Aurorablade
aca9d31853 almossstttttt 2015-12-12 18:45:07 -05:00
Aurorablade
374867baf7 Now channeling beepsky 2015-12-11 14:57:41 -05:00